
When considering whether stiff golf clubs are better, it’s essential to understand that the choice depends on a golfer’s swing speed, strength, and skill level. Stiff shafts are generally recommended for players with faster swing speeds, typically above 90 mph, as they provide more control and reduce the tendency for the club to twist at impact. However, for golfers with slower swing speeds, stiff shafts can hinder performance by making it harder to achieve optimal launch and distance. Ultimately, the better option is subjective and should be determined through personal testing and fitting to ensure the clubs align with the individual’s unique swing characteristics.

Stiff vs. Regular Flex: Performance Differences
The choice between stiff and regular flex golf clubs hinges on swing speed, a metric that dictates how the shaft responds to your force. Stiff shafts, designed for faster swings (typically over 90 mph), minimize excessive bending, ensuring the clubface remains stable through impact. Regular flex shafts, suited for slower swings (under 85 mph), offer more whip, helping golfers achieve optimal launch and distance despite reduced power. Mismatching flex to swing speed leads to inefficiencies: a stiff shaft for a slow swing results in low, weak shots, while a regular flex for a fast swing causes over-bending and inconsistent ball striking.
Consider the case of a mid-handicap golfer transitioning from regular to stiff flex. Initially, they may notice a loss of distance due to the stiffer shaft’s reduced flex. However, as their swing speed improves—perhaps through coaching or strength training—the stiff shaft begins to maximize their power, delivering straighter, more controlled shots. Conversely, a beginner with a 70 mph swing speed would benefit from a regular flex, as it compensates for their lack of force by adding loft and carry distance. The key is aligning shaft flex with current swing dynamics, not aspirational goals.
To determine the right flex, measure your swing speed using a launch monitor, available at most golf retailers. Pair this data with a clubfitting session to assess how different shafts perform in real-world conditions. For instance, a golfer with an 88 mph swing might test both stiff and regular shafts to compare ball flight, spin rates, and dispersion patterns. Practical tip: if you consistently hit the ball low with a regular flex or struggle with slicing, a stiffer shaft could provide the stability needed to correct these issues.
While stiff shafts are often associated with advanced players, they are not inherently "better"—they are simply better suited to specific swing profiles. Regular flex shafts excel in helping slower-swinging golfers achieve playable distances and trajectories. The performance difference lies in how each flex interacts with the golfer’s mechanics. Stiff shafts prioritize control and precision for powerful swings, while regular flex shafts focus on maximizing energy transfer for less forceful swings. Ultimately, the "better" choice is the one that complements your unique swing characteristics.

Impact of Swing Speed on Club Stiffness
Swing speed is the silent architect of your golf game, dictating the harmony between player and club. A faster swing speed generates more power, but only when paired with the right shaft stiffness. Imagine a whip: too stiff, and it fails to flex, robbing you of energy transfer; too flexible, and it bends excessively, sacrificing control. This principle applies directly to golf clubs. Players with swing speeds above 100 mph often benefit from stiff or extra-stiff shafts, as these minimize unwanted flex, ensuring the clubface remains square at impact. Conversely, golfers with speeds below 90 mph typically fare better with regular or senior flex shafts, which allow for optimal energy loading and release.
Analyzing the relationship between swing speed and shaft stiffness reveals a critical threshold. For instance, a golfer with a 95 mph swing speed might find a stiff shaft too rigid, leading to a loss of distance and accuracy. Conversely, a player with a 110 mph swing speed using a regular flex shaft would experience excessive clubhead lag, causing inconsistent ball striking. The sweet spot lies in matching the shaft’s flex to the player’s tempo and power output. A simple rule of thumb: if your driver carry distance is consistently below your potential, or if you notice a fade or slice without intending to, your shaft stiffness might be misaligned with your swing speed.
To determine the ideal stiffness, consider a professional club fitting session. Fitters use launch monitors to measure swing speed, ball flight, and spin rates, providing data-driven recommendations. For DIY enthusiasts, a practical tip is to test clubs on a driving range, focusing on feel and performance. If the club feels “whippy” or the ball balloons with excessive spin, the shaft is likely too flexible. If it feels board-like and unresponsive, it’s too stiff. Remember, age and physical condition also play a role; younger, stronger players often have higher swing speeds, while seniors may benefit from more flexible shafts to compensate for reduced power.
The takeaway is clear: shaft stiffness is not a one-size-fits-all solution. It’s a precision tool calibrated to your swing speed. Misalignment can lead to inefficiencies, from lost yards to erratic shots. By understanding this dynamic, golfers can make informed decisions, optimizing their equipment to match their natural abilities. Whether you’re a weekend warrior or a seasoned pro, the right stiffness transforms potential energy into kinetic power, turning good swings into great shots.

Pros and Cons of Stiff Shafts
Stiff shafts in golf clubs are often associated with faster swing speeds, but their effectiveness depends on a player's individual mechanics and strength. For golfers with a swing speed exceeding 100 mph, stiff shafts can provide better control and accuracy by reducing the club's tendency to twist during the swing. However, this benefit is not universal; players with slower swing speeds may find stiff shafts too rigid, leading to a loss of distance and feel. Understanding this relationship is crucial for optimizing performance.
Consider the trade-offs when choosing stiff shafts. On the positive side, they offer enhanced stability, particularly for strong, aggressive swingers. This stability can lead to more consistent ball striking and improved shot dispersion. For example, a golfer with a 110 mph swing speed might notice tighter fairway clusters and fewer mishits after switching to stiff shafts. However, the downside is that stiff shafts demand more physical power to load properly. Golfers with moderate swing speeds or those lacking strength may struggle to achieve optimal launch conditions, resulting in lower ball flights and reduced carry distance.
To determine if stiff shafts are right for you, follow these steps: first, measure your swing speed using a launch monitor. If it consistently exceeds 100 mph, stiff shafts could be a viable option. Second, assess your strength and flexibility. Stronger players with a dynamic swing are better suited to handle the rigidity of stiff shafts. Finally, test different shaft flexes on the course or range. Pay attention to how each feels during the swing and the resulting ball flight. Practical tip: borrow or demo clubs with stiff shafts before committing to a purchase.
One common misconception is that stiff shafts automatically equate to better performance. While they can benefit high-speed swingers, they are not a one-size-fits-all solution. For instance, a senior golfer with a 90 mph swing speed might lose 10-15 yards by using stiff shafts instead of regular flex. The key is matching the shaft flex to your unique swing profile. Overlooking this can lead to frustration and hindered progress. Always prioritize fit over perceived prestige.
In conclusion, stiff shafts offer distinct advantages for golfers with the right swing characteristics but come with limitations for others. By analyzing swing speed, strength, and personal feel, players can make an informed decision. Remember, the goal is not to follow trends but to find the equipment that maximizes individual performance. Stiff shafts can be a powerful tool when used appropriately, but they require careful consideration to avoid counterproductive results.

Stiff Clubs for Beginners: Suitable or Not?
Stiff golf clubs are often associated with experienced players who generate high swing speeds, but beginners might wonder if they could benefit from this shaft flexibility. The key lies in understanding the relationship between swing speed and shaft performance. A stiff shaft is designed to minimize flex, providing more control and accuracy for faster swings. However, beginners typically have slower swing speeds, which can make stiff clubs harder to use effectively. Using a stiff shaft with insufficient speed can lead to poor ball contact, reduced distance, and inconsistent shots. For most newcomers, a regular or senior flex shaft is more suitable, as it allows the clubhead to load and unload properly, maximizing distance and forgiveness.
Consider the analogy of a bow and arrow: too much tension in the bowstring (stiff shaft) without enough strength to draw it (swing speed) results in a weak, inaccurate shot. Similarly, beginners often struggle to activate a stiff shaft, leading to a loss of potential energy transfer to the ball. Golf instructors frequently recommend starting with a more flexible shaft to build confidence and consistency. As a beginner, focus on developing a smooth, repeatable swing before experimenting with stiffer options. This approach ensures you’re not fighting your equipment while learning the fundamentals.
That said, there are exceptions. Younger, athletic beginners or those transitioning from sports requiring explosive movements (e.g., baseball, tennis) might generate enough speed to handle a stiff shaft. If your swing speed consistently exceeds 90 mph with a driver, a stiff shaft could be worth considering. However, this is rare among true beginners. A professional club fitting is essential in such cases to ensure the shaft matches your unique swing dynamics. Without proper guidance, opting for a stiff shaft prematurely can hinder progress and discourage new players.
Practical advice for beginners: start with a regular flex shaft and prioritize learning proper technique. Invest in lessons to improve swing mechanics and speed naturally. Once you’ve established a solid foundation and notice consistent ball striking, consult a club fitter to reassess your needs. Upgrading to a stiff shaft should be a gradual, informed decision, not an initial choice. Remember, the goal is to work *with* your equipment, not against it, especially in the early stages of your golf journey.

How Stiffness Affects Distance and Accuracy
The stiffness of a golf club shaft, often referred to as flex, plays a pivotal role in how energy is transferred from the golfer to the ball. A stiffer shaft generally reduces the amount of flex during the swing, which can lead to increased control for golfers with faster swing speeds. However, this doesn’t automatically translate to better performance for everyone. For instance, a golfer with a swing speed of 100 mph might benefit from a stiff shaft, as it minimizes the club’s lag, allowing for a more precise strike. Conversely, a golfer with a slower swing speed (below 90 mph) may find a stiff shaft too rigid, resulting in reduced distance and accuracy due to inadequate energy transfer.
To understand how stiffness affects distance, consider the concept of "whipping" action. A shaft with the right amount of flex for a golfer’s swing speed stores and releases energy efficiently, much like a whip cracking. For example, a regular flex shaft (suited for swing speeds of 85–95 mph) provides enough give to maximize distance for mid-range swing speeds. If a golfer in this category uses a stiff shaft, the reduced flex can lead to a loss of 10–15 yards off the tee, as the club fails to optimize the energy generated by the swing. Conversely, a golfer with a 110 mph swing using a regular flex shaft may experience an over-flexing effect, causing the clubface to close too quickly and result in inconsistent ball flight.
Accuracy is equally influenced by shaft stiffness, particularly in terms of dispersion. A shaft that’s too stiff for a golfer’s swing can lead to a harsher feel at impact, making it harder to square the clubface consistently. For example, a high-handicap golfer with a moderate swing speed (80–90 mph) using a stiff shaft might struggle with a left-to-right ball flight (for right-handed golfers) due to the inability to release the club properly. On the other hand, a stiffer shaft can improve accuracy for skilled players with faster swings by reducing the variability in clubhead movement during the downswing.
Practical tips for optimizing stiffness include a club fitting session, where professionals analyze swing speed, tempo, and attack angle to recommend the appropriate flex. For DIY adjustments, golfers can experiment with different shafts during practice sessions, focusing on how each affects ball flight and feel. A useful rule of thumb: if you consistently hit shots low with a fading tendency, the shaft might be too stiff; if shots balloon or hook excessively, it might be too flexible. Ultimately, the goal is to match the shaft’s stiffness to the golfer’s dynamics, ensuring a harmonious blend of distance and accuracy tailored to their unique swing profile.
